Pigeon masters from across the globe compete in the highest-stakes bird races on the planet. Fame, fortune and livelihoods rest on the wings of these feathered athletes in this hilarious and charming story.
1976
1993
1919
2001
2003
1967
2017
1978
2007
1977
1997
1990
1986
1975
1984
1985